Starting Point & Logistics

Your adventure begins with a simple, practical meeting at a private farm on the outskirts of Lagoa. The instructions are clear — just look for a house with a green gate on the curve, turn right, and follow a short dusty road. Parking is safe and private, which is a relief compared to crowded beaches. You’ll receive the exact meeting details via WhatsApp a day beforehand, making logistics straightforward.

Once there, you’ll get a brief safety and orientation session. This sets the tone for a relaxed, well-organized outing. The guides are certified, friendly, and eager to share their knowledge, making sure everyone feels confident before heading into the water.

The Kayak Itinerary

The tour’s core is a two-hour paddle through some of the most stunning parts of the coastline. You’ll start just beside Benagil, avoiding the chaotic crowds that flock directly to the main beach. Instead, you’ll be launched from your own private beach, a peaceful spot that feels like your personal paradise.

From the start, the focus is on discovering secluded caves and quiet beaches. The guides point out rock formations and share stories about the area’s geology and natural history, adding an educational layer to the experience. Visiting the Benagil Cave

Of course, no kayaking tour of this region is complete without seeing the famous Benagil Cave. It’s truly a sight — a natural skylight illuminating the interior of the cave, visible from your kayak or on a quick stop. The guides are mindful of local laws, so the group doesn’t linger too long at the main cave, but you still get plenty of time to marvel and take photographs.

Several reviewers mention how early starts give the group a quiet window to enjoy the caves before the crowds arrive. One shared that their trip “got us to the caves before everyone else,” which means fewer people in your photos and a more peaceful experience.

Safety & Suitability

While the activity is safe for most, it’s important to note the limitations. The tour isn’t suitable for children under 5, pregnant women, or anyone with mobility issues, back problems, or certain health concerns (heart, epilepsy, diabetes, etc.). The physicality of paddling means a moderate level of fitness is recommended, and those over 220 lbs (100 kg) might find it uncomfortable.

Reviewers repeatedly highlight how guides prioritize safety and comfort, giving clear instructions and adjusting the pace for the group. The small group size adds to this sense of security.
